The Freshman shooting team lost to the Yale freshmen at New Haven Saturday afternoon by the score of 167 to 196, out of a possible 250. The best individual score was made by O. Noel of Yale, who broke 44 out of 50 birds.
The score follows:
Yale--O. Noel, 44; Thompson, 43; Morrison, 40; J. Noel, 35; Dimock, 34. Total, 196.
Harvard--Storer, 42; Pearson, 41; Wells, 36; Stewart, 35; Reed, 13. Total, 167.
